read the original abstract

We study the dispersion of the $\pi$ resonance in the superconducting state within the projected SO(5) model\cite{project}. Away from the the commensurate momentum, the propagation of the $\pi$ resonance creates phase slips in the superconducting order parameter. This frustration effect leads to a strong dressing of the $\pi$ resonance and a downwards dispersion away from the commensurate wave vector. Based on these results, we argue that the the commensurate resonance and incommensurate magnetic fluctuations in the cuprates are continuously connected.
